I think the point behind having a silent character (with a few exceptions) is to enhance the thought that YOU the player are the protagonist. The games that I am thinking about often had the non player characters (NPCs) respond to implied dialog by the player character. Zelda for example, and Chrono Trigger (a game I forgot had a silent protagonist), and in the first Half Life with Gordon (although they changed that stance in the second half life to play up the fact that he didn't talk).
To have some of these talk would alltogehter change the way the player experienced the game. It wouldn't nessecarily made the games bad, but it would have changed our preception of them. I wish more games would adopt the silent protagonist, but FULLY recognize that it's not for every game. (GTA4 with a silent protagonist would have been difficult).
